Message in a Bottle

Facebook App

Naked Juice has a thriving community on Facebook, and they have a new, environmentally conscious bottling initiative called the reNEWabottle—it’s a bottle made from 100% recyclable products, plus it’s 100% recycled. As a means of spreading the message we recommended and created a Facebook application that urges FB users to pass bottles to friends within their own micro-communities.

In creating the application, we knew that there had to be an incentive beyond plastering a friend’s sacred wall with a marketing piece (an act that could be deemed somewhat intrusive). To that end, we advised Naked Juice to continue their environmental stewardship and make a donation based on the amount of bottles passed; they agreed to $20,000 for Keep America Beautiful, a non-profit organization that literally helps keep America beautiful.

From a marketing standpoint, we opted to forgo an expensive media and PR blitz, and truly placed the campaign in the hands of the community to create a successful viral movement.

After an aggressive timeline and the various technical challenges that are married to the Facebook API, the campaign launched with favorable praise, and has shown success in community engagement as a viral piece as well as a positive driver for community growth.
